All season, Kentucky head coach Mark Pope has praised Brandon Garrison and talked about how high his ceiling is. On Wednesday night, in UK’s 83-82 win over Oklahoma, Garrison showed that potential with one of his best games of the season.
Garrison had 12 points, four rebounds, three steals and two blocks in the victory. He played a key role down the stretch as the Cats pulled out a tight road game in the Southeastern Conference. Pope was impressed with Garrison on Wednesday.
“I thought he had an unbelievable defensive effort,” Pope said. “It was the best focus he’s had, the best energy he’s had. I thought he was really terrific.”
Pope knows that Garrison is a key cog in what this Kentucky team does on the defensive end of the floor.
“It means a lot to us. It’s actually really important,” Pope said. “I thought he was really special on the defensive end and he’s doing good things on the offensive end, too. I do think it’s a place where he’s growing. He’s made a huge jump from last year. I love the fact that he made multiple threes in the game at Oklahoma and all we want to talk about it his defense. That’s how impactful he was at the defensive end.”
Now, the challenge gets even bigger for Garrison and Kentucky as the Cats welcome top-ranked Auburn to Rupp Arena on Saturday (1 p.m. ET, ABC). Bruce Pearl’s Tigers are 26-2 overall and 14-1 in the SEC. Pope says that the Tigers do a lot of things very well.
“There’s a lot to see that makes them so good,” Pope said. “Most of the time, he’s got five guys on the floor who are capable of putting up 20 on any given night. They are incredible shot makers. They make difficult shots.”
Auburn’s best player is senior Johni Broome, a candidate for the national player of the year. Broome is averaging 18.8 points and 11.0 rebounds per game. He also leads the Tigers in assists and blocked shots. Pope knows that Broome is playing as well as anyone in the country.
“He’s a terrific talent,” Pope said. “He’s a veteran guy. He plays at a really high level. He can space out the floor and make shots there. His speed, he’s super, super physical. Really, really creative. Just a great player.”
Garrison, along with Amari Williams, will need their best defensive effort on Saturday to slow down Broome and the high-flying Tigers. Perhaps Wednesday’s game was a window to what’s to come for the UK interior defense.
